As of the end of this sitting week 210 Government bills passed between 2022 and November 2025.
Among the highlights of this term, the Malinauskas Labor Government passed world leading laws to ban political donations and get money out of politics, secured the long-term future of the Whyalla Steelworks and associated mines, legislated for the strongest laws in the nation to keep serious repeat child sex offenders locked up with laws passed for indefinite detention and lifetime electronic monitoring, passed the toughest knife laws in the nation, established a First Nations Voice to Parliament, legislated the state’s first Biodiversity Act, banned puppy farms, delivered legislation to protect the iconic Crown and Anchor Hotel and reserve its rights to play live music, and abolished the Liberals’ Electric Vehicle Tax.

In health, we are building more than 600 new beds across public hospitals, have recruited 2,794 health workers above attrition: nurses, doctors, ambos, and allied health workers, built 10 new ambulance stations and are delivering 5 more, as well as opening 4 new 24/7 pharmacies.
SA is building with construction of a non-stop South Road and New Women’s and Children’s Hospital underway, while we’ve completed the Majors Road On/Off Ramp, the Port Dock Rail Spur and completing construction of the new Adelaide Aquatic Centre.
